Nuveen New York Municipal Valu (NYSE:NNY) Short Interest Up 36.5% in May

Nuveen New York Municipal Value Fund logo with Finance background

Nuveen New York Municipal Valu (NYSE:NNY - Get Free Report) was the recipient of a large growth in short interest in the month of May. As of May 31st, there was short interest totalling 13,100 shares, a growth of 36.5% from the May 15th total of 9,600 shares. Approximately 0.1% of the shares of the company are short sold.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 41,200 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.3 days.

Nuveen New York Municipal Valu Trading Up 0.1%

Shares of NNY stock traded up $0.01 during mid-day trading on Friday, reaching $8.05. The company's stock had a trading volume of 14,929 shares, compared to its average volume of 50,674. The firm's 50-day moving average is $8.15 and its two-hundred day moving average is $8.19. Nuveen New York Municipal Valu has a 1-year low of $7.77 and a 1-year high of $8.87.

Nuveen New York Municipal Valu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a monthly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, July 1st. Investors of record on Friday, June 13th will be given a $0.0295 dividend. This represents a $0.35 annualized dividend and a yield of 4.40%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, June 13th.

Nuveen New York Municipal Valu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Nuveen New York Municipal Value Fund, Inc is a closed-ended fixed income mutual fund launched by Nuveen Investments, Inc The fund is co-managed by Nuveen Fund Advisors LLC and Nuveen Asset Management, LLC. It invests in the fixed income markets of New York. The fund invests in tax exempt municipal bonds, with a rating of Baa/BBB or higher.
